Pudding Lane


City, 2, Eastcheap. (EC3) Here is where the Great Fire of London broke out after twelve o'clock on the night of September 2, 1666. The fire started in the house of a man named Farryner, the King's baker, close to the spot where the Monument now stands. (Reference: Jesse's London, vol. II, p. 297)
